When I first saw the picture of this Yellow Fiat I knew I wanted to build something similar.  I ordered the Tamiya kit from my local hobby shop and even though it is a 1/24 scale kit this Gentleman is small.  I'm shoving a Blown SBC that I printed out in the business end and only running one seat.  So far I'm liking how it's looking.
